In 25, after Liu Xiu proclaimed himself emperor of a restored Han dynasty (as
Emperor Guangwu), Guo was created an imperial consort. That year, she gave birth to his first son, Liu Jiang (劉疆). Her position would not change, even though her uncle Liu Yang was suspected of planning a rebellion and

Also in 26, Emperor
Guangwu considered creating an empress. He favored his first love, Consort Yin. However, Consort Yin had not yet had a son by that point, and she declined the empress position and endorsed Consort Guo. Emperor Guangwu therefore created Guo empress and her son Prince Jiang

Empress Guo did not suffer the fate of other deposed empresses in history, however—imprisonment or death. Rather, Emperor

After
Empress Guo was deposed, Emperor Guangwu continued to bestow her family honors as would otherwise befit an empress' family. Her brother Guo Kuang, already a marquess, was bestowed a large

In 52, Princess
Dowager Guo died at the age of 46 and was buried with honors, but not the honors of an empress, nor was she buried at Emperor Guangwu's eventual tomb.
